Engaging with the language daily

Incorporating English into your daily routine is vital for building fluency and confidence. This doesn’t mean you need to spend hours studying grammar rules or vocabulary lists. Instead, aim for small, consistent interactions with the language. You could listen to English podcasts during your commute, watch your favorite movies in English, or even switch your phone’s language settings. These simple acts can help you become more familiar with the sounds and rhythms of English, making it easier to express yourself when the time comes.

Finding your voice through reading

Reading is a wonderful way to enhance your vocabulary and improve your understanding of sentence structure. Choose materials that resonate with you, whether it’s novels, articles, or blogs. As you immerse yourself in the written word, pay attention to how ideas are expressed and the nuances of language. You might even find that reading aloud helps you practice your pronunciation and builds your confidence. The more you engage with the language, the more comfortable you will feel using it.

The power of conversation

Engaging in conversation is perhaps the most effective way to build your speaking skills. Start with simple exchanges, perhaps with friends or family members who are supportive of your learning journey. As you gain confidence, seek out opportunities to converse with native speakers. This could be through language exchange programs, local meetups, or even online platforms. The key is to focus on the joy of communication rather than perfection. Remember, the goal is to express yourself, not to deliver a flawless performance.

Listening as a tool for growth

Listening is just as important as speaking when it comes to language learning. By exposing yourself to different accents, dialects, and speaking styles, you can develop a richer understanding of the language. Try to listen actively, paying attention to the way words are pronounced and the rhythm of conversations. This will not only enhance your comprehension skills but also give you valuable insights into how to construct your own sentences naturally.

Setting realistic goals

Goal-setting can be a powerful motivator, but it’s important to set achievable targets. Rather than aiming for perfection, focus on incremental progress. For instance, you might set a goal to learn five new words each week or to engage in a short conversation in English every day. Celebrating these small victories can provide a sense of accomplishment and encourage you to keep pushing forward.
